An ideal blend of urban amenities and suburban streets, West Chester is a part of the Philadelphia metro area, located only 25 miles west of downtown. Home to the West Chester University of Pennsylvania, the city offers a pleasant blend of families, professionals, students, and faculty. West Chester is known for its historic charm and offers several historical landmarks and longstanding architecture. An array of local and chain restaurant, bars, and breweries await in Downtown West Chester, giving residents a wide variety of dining options. The city is known for its top performing public school district, so families are more than happy living here. A mix of longstanding homes and modern, upscale apartments are available for rent in West Chester.

I have lived here over a year and it's been a pleasant experience. There's shopping and parks nearby, along with a quiet community. The leasing office staff is wonderful and helpful. No laundry in my unit, but there's facilities in the basement. Parking can get filled up quickly, but there's more than enough spaces and walking twenty more feet is only slightly inconvenient. Overall a wonderful place to be .
I enjoyed living at Goshen Manor. The maintenance staff is friendly and fast. The office team is friendly as well. They also made time for me regardless if I just walked in or called, they helped me when I needed it and answered my questions. My apartment had a lot of closets for storage. I like the floor plan. The parking is free and all over the place so I didn't mind if I came in later in the evening and had to walk a little further to my front door. The grocery store is a short walk which made it less painful if I forgot to buy something. Plus there's a Panera and Qdoba close too. I didn't have many issues with my apartment other than a light bulb change and battery replacement for the alarms. The buildings are older so they can be loud in places and if your neighbors are loud you will hear them. They keep the grounds clean and there are trees everywhere (I like that). My apartment also got a lot of sunlight. Nobody bothered me other than a short greeting...that was a big plus. Overall, I liked it a lot.
Goshen Manor has its pros. The biggest is...UTILITIES! The best thing here is that your utilities are paid for. You only pay for electric and cable/internet. That is awesome. The apartments are a good size and have a functional layout. Big windows. However, the cons have really made me want to run for the hills a couple of times. Parking here is scarce and driving through the lot is confusing and dangerous because there are no one-way arrows (in clearly a one-way parking lot), and there is only room for one car to pass through at a time. You can probably imagine the chaos around rush hour when everyone is trying to get home. The walls are incredibly thin, the floors are crazy loud. Be prepared to hear everything your neighbors do. Also, be prepared to have issues if your apartment has not been recently updated. Electrical issues, plumbing issues, leaks, and small issues that make you scratch your head and think, "why didn't anyone fix this before new residents moved in?" We came from a Home Properties complex, so our standards were probably too high when you compare to a Berger property. Like I said, the best thing is having utilities included. However, if I would have known the difference in quality and upkeep for the apartments, I may have opted to stay with Home Properties. Please know that your rent does reflect the quality of your apartment. The office staff will tell you this when you come to look, and then deny that they ever said such a thing when you're having issues. Proceed with caution, because low rent in West Chester is always too good to be true. Aim high and you will find yourself in an updated apartment, hopefully without the issues I've experienced.
